Aetna Life Insurance Co. on Wednesday appealed a lower court's decision to throw out fraud allegations in a lawsuit against the North Cypress Medical Center, a hospital that prides itself on its hotel-like amenities. The insurance company wasted little time after U.S. Senior District Judge Kenneth Hoyt ruled that there was no merit in Aetna's allegations that North Cypress Medical Center had committed common law fraud, health care fraud or misrepresented medical billing records, in a decision he issued last week.
